George Wiseman

Birth5 August 1802 - Pruntytown, Harrison [now Taylor, West] Virginia
Death27 November 1877 - Taylor County, West Virginia, USA
MotherElizabeth Anderson
FatherThomas Wiseman

Born in Pruntytown, Harrison [now Taylor, West] Virginia on 5 August 1802 to Thomas Wiseman and Elizabeth Anderson. George Wiseman married Hellen (Ealon) Mary Carder and had 14 children. He passed away on 27 November 1877 in Taylor County, West Virginia, USA.
